Poprad Landscape Park

A wooded valley on the Slovak border where mineral springs made a line of spa towns, and where the river runs north.

The Poprad is unusual: it rises in Slovakia on the southern side of the Tatras and then cuts north through the Carpathian ridge into Poland, which is the wrong way for a river in this region and gives the valley its shape - a wooded gorge with the border running through it and a railway threading along the bank. The park covers about fifty thousand hectares of that country, mostly beech and fir, and what made the valley prosperous is underground: carbonated mineral waters come up along faults here in quantity, and the spa towns of Krynica, Muszyna, Zegiestow and Piwniczna were built on them from the nineteenth century, with pump rooms, promenades and wooden villas. Several springs are free to drink from and the waters are heavily mineralised and taste of it. Walking is on gentle wooded ridges. The Lemko villages of the valley have wooden churches, several of them UNESCO-listed in the wider group.

What you actually see

  • A river running north - the Poprad cutting through the Carpathian ridge the wrong way.
  • Carbonated springs - mineral waters rising along faults, free to drink at the pump rooms.
  • Nineteenth-century spas - Krynica, Muszyna and Zegiestow with villas and promenades.
  • Lemko wooden churches - in the valley villages, several UNESCO-listed.

Honest expectations

The mineral waters are strongly flavoured and not to everyone's taste. Spa towns are busy in summer and prices rise. Walking here is gentle rather than dramatic. Some wooden churches are locked and need a keyholder.
